Some people say that cites are like big machines, busy, intricate and one moving thing. Well, our city is like a computer. Everything is programed here, the houses, the streets, the cars. Cars would be wired to go by themselves, street lights coded to turn off at certain times at night but still use motion censors. Children keep holographic pets that are used to identify them or track them. If you tell your house you want to have a certain food it would check the fridge and tell you what you needed to buy, or even order it for you. Even your shirt is wired to sense the temperatures around and warm or cool you depending on it.
But the thing about this technology that everyone relies on is that it's delicate. It's easy to mess up one thing and shut down the entire city and the lives that rely on it whether on accident... or on purpose. The black market has plenty of hackers for hire. You can add or destroy things in the city by using a technology called 'CyberRealm"
With Cyberrealm, you use goggles and wires connected to your spine to go into a cyber world where it's easier to program, hack and so forth. But if you are killed or die in the cyberrealm, you die in the real world too. What the hackers do is a federal crime taken very seriously, and an entire branch of police is dedicated to arresting hackers. But is what the hackers are doing truly wrong?
